Noir is a distinguished modern French restaurant nestled in the affluent 7th arrondissement of Paris. It offers a refined culinary journey with a focus on contemporary interpretations of classic French dishes, utilizing high-quality seasonal ingredients. The establishment is celebrated for its elegant and intimate setting, making it a prime destination for special occasions and discerning diners seeking a sophisticated gastronomic experience.

Busy hours are typically evenings, especially Thursday through Saturday. Reservations are highly recommended, particularly for prime dining slots.
Seating is intimate and limited, emphasizing the need for advance booking to secure a table, especially for groups or during peak times.
The noise level is generally moderate, conducive to comfortable conversation and maintaining the restaurant’s elegant, intimate ambiance.
Staff are proficient in both French and English, ensuring clear communication and a welcoming experience for international guests.
Wi-Fi is available for guests, providing connectivity if needed, though it is not a primary focus for the dining experience.
No dedicated parking. Street parking in the 7th arrondissement is challenging; public parking garages are available within a short walking distance.
The restaurant offers ground floor access and is generally accessible, accommodating guests with mobility considerations.
Located in an upscale, quiet residential and diplomatic district, close to iconic Parisian landmarks like the Eiffel Tower and Les Invalides.
